Sandra Seacat is an American actress, director and acting coach. Seacat was best known for innovations in acting pedagogy-blending elements of Strasberg, and Jungian dream analysis and for a handful of coaching success stories.

Seacat taught at the Lee Strasberg Theatre Institute, City College of New York’s Leonard Davis Centre for the Performing Arts, and the Actors Studio, and she taught privately.

In 2012 and 2013, Seacat was a faculty member at the annual Film Forum hosted at the University of Arkansas’s Winthrop Rockefeller Institute, organised by fellow Actors Studio alumnus Robert Walden.
Sandra Cat died on January 17, 2023. The actual cause of her death is unknown.
